Blueberry Banana Overnight Oats

A quick, easy, and nutritious breakfast option that saves time and keeps you full. Perfect for busy mornings with fresh fruit, oats, and optional additions for flavor.
Prep Time 5 minutes
Total Time 4 hours
Servings: 1 serving
Course: Breakfast
Cuisine: American
Calories: 290

Ingredients
  

Main Ingredients
  • 1/2 cup old-fashioned rolled oats Not the instant kind
  • 1/2 cup milk Use 2 percent, almond, or oat milk
  • 1/2 piece banana The riper, the better
  • a handful fresh blueberries Can use frozen blueberries
  • 1 tablespoon chia seeds Optional for thickness
  • a dash cinnamon Optional for flavor
  • 1 tablespoon honey or maple syrup Adjust based on sweetness preference
  • a pinch salt Essential for flavor

Method
 

Preparation
  1. Grab a jar or a bowl.
  2. Dump in your oats, milk, chia seeds, cinnamon, and salt. Mix it around a bit.
  3. Mash the banana with a fork and stir it in.
  4. Add blueberries, using frozen ones directly from the freezer if preferred.
  5. Drizzle on honey or syrup if desired.
  6. Cover and stick it in the fridge overnight or for at least four hours.
  7. Wake up, give it one last stir, and enjoy your breakfast.

Notes

For creaminess, use full-fat milk or add yogurt. If the oats look dry after chilling, splash in a bit more milk when ready to eat. Remaining oats can be stored in a tight container in the fridge for up to 4 days.
